Main Pharmacy at Scott handling all new prescriptions

Starting May 18, the Scott Air Force Base Main Pharmacy will process and dispense all new prescriptions in the Clinic located at 310 W. Losey St.

"We are consolidating all new prescription processing for on-base and off-base providers at the main pharmacy location in the main clinic," said Tech. Sgt. Anna Anderson, 375th Medical Support Squadron clinic pharmacy NCO in charge.

"All refill prescriptions (that patients request via the automated phone system) will continue to be processed and available for pick-up at the Satellite Pharmacy located at 312 W. Winters St."

To compensate for the move, the pharmacy flight will shift additional personnel to the main pharmacy location to accommodate the workload.

"The pharmacy flight needs to align available technician staff to better support Scott pharmacy patron needs," said Anderson. "We determined maintaining two full service pharmacy locations was not the most efficient use of our current staff and caused unnecessary service delays and confusion for our pharmacy patrons."

This change will improve the process of new prescriptions for its patrons and eliminate any confusion regarding which site services which type of prescription.

"Now it's simple; if it's a new prescription from any provider, Scott pharmacy patrons go the main pharmacy location," said Anderson.

"If you need a refill of your medication, call the Scott Refill line at 256-7400, enter the desired prescription numbers, and the medications will be available for pick up in two duty days at the Satellite Pharmacy."

The Pharmacy's priority is its patrons and finding better ways to serve them in their time of need.

Anderson said, "Our goal is to improve the safety and efficiency of prescription services for Scott pharmacy patrons and ease operational stress on the pharmacy staff."
